Description
The study of biology and politics examines the linkage between the life sciences (broadly defined) and politics.
Among biological areas from which these linkages are drawn include: human ethology; socio-biology; ethology; genetics; evolutionary theory; neurosciences; biotechnology; and, bioethics amongst others.
These knowledge arenas are used to illuminate policy choices (biopolicy), political behaviour, leadership behaviour, international politics, and political philosophy, amongst others.
Topics covered by this volume include human nature in the theory and practice of modern international relations; decision-making under uncertainty; political culture and AIDS policy; and, emerging political leadership in young adults.
